This article is about the character in Pacific Rim: Aftermath. You may be looking for the character in Pacific Rim: Amara.


"Mech Czar" is the alias of a Black market dealer working the Santa Monica, California area.[1]

Biography[]

Early Life[]

Mech Czar is a Ukrainian[2] crime boss with a longstanding rivalry with Santa Monica-based crime boss, Giovanni Capello.[1] At some point, she lost a limb and had it replaced with a bulky, cybernetic limb. She bears scars on her face resembling the pattern of a computer chip.[3]

Czar holds considerable power within the Black Market. In the aftermath of the war, Czar oversees the development of an prototype Jaeger named Enforcer, using what remained of the original Jaegers produced by the Pan Pacific Defense Corps.[1]

Aftermath[]

March 3, 2034[]

Mech hires former Jaeger pilot Joshua Griffin to work for her. On her order, Griffin and four other individuals are sent to a sealed scrapyard in Santa Monica to salvage Jaeger parts.[1] During their attempt to take salvage from the scrapyard, they are ambushed by men under the order of Giovanni Capello.

Griffin is able to obtain a synaptic capacitor from the Conn-Pod of Vulcan Specter and returns to Mech Czar's Headquarters in Los Angeles.[3]

Czar arrives to the garage area, stepping into the middle of a fight between Pena and Griffin, demanding that they give the synaptic capacitor to Chris Dubango. She interrupts Chris' rambling about the problems the capacitor will solve with their Jaegger Enforcer, and orders Griffin and Pena to tell her about the Giovanni's men at the scrapyard.

Griffin explains to Czar that Giovanni's men were armed with Marrow Bombs, explosives powered by fossil fuels. His explanation is cut short when the perimeter alarm around her headquarter is set off. Czar asks for a situation report, when an explosion tears a hole through the building.

Realizing they've been ambushed, Czar orders everyone to make for the workshop and lays down suppressing fire on Giovanni's men. Chris tries to get everyone in the panic room, but Czar tells him to use the synaptic capacitor instead. When Griffin uses the capacitor to power Enforcer, he struggles to suppress Giovanni's men. Pena asks that Czar give him the chance to pilot Enforcer instead.[2]
